WILL I HAVE TO SHARE CUSTODY OF MY NEWBORN WHILE I’M BREAST FEEDING?

QUESTION: I'm expecting a baby soon and the father and I are no longer together. Will I have to share custody with the father when I'm breast feeding and my baby is so young?

MY RESPONSE: Possibly, at least to some extent. But before he has any orders that he could enforce, he would have to file a Paternity case, and a Request for Order (formally called an Order to Show Cause before July 1, 2012) seeking custody and/or visitation rights. You would best consult with (and preferably retain) an experienced Family Law Attorney to represent you if the dad files a Paternity case.
